an independent contractor agreement is a contract that allows a client to hire a contractor for a particular job the agreement may also be known as a 1099 agreement after the number of the internal revenue service form that an independent contractor will be required to file unlike employees independent contractors do not automatically get taxes deducted from their payment and must pay them on their own when income taxes come due the collection of taxes is just one of the many docHub legal differences between independent contractors and employees in general independent contracting generally offers greater flexibility but less stability over the last decade or so independent contractor positions have grown much more quickly than the workforce at large in part because of changing technology whether youre an employer or a worker here are a few things to consider about independent contractor agreements before drawing up an independent contractor agreement consider is the work eligible
